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de Studio en Gretna

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Gretna?

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Gretna está en Skyview Terrace listado en $795.

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de Studio en Gretna?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ento de Studio en Gretna es $1,123.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de Studio más grande disponible en Gretna ?

A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Gretna es una unidad de 718 pies cuadrados a partir de $1,450 en 925 Common.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de Studio en Gretna?

El tamaño medio de un alquiler de Studio en Gretna es actualmente de 290 pies cuadrados.
